The Bears knocked off the #6 regionally ranked Ace’s Wednesday night by a 2-0 margin in Evansville.
Despite being out shot by the Aces (7-5-1, 0-2-0) the Bears downed the Aces with stellar goal-play by Alex Riggs. The Bears opened the scoring four minutes before the half when Gerard Barbero dibbled in and blasted in a shot that ricocheted off of the crossbar from 20 yards. The goal was Barbero’s first of the season and gave the Bears the 1-0 lead.
The Bear’s move to 1-1 in Conference play, 4-7-3 overall.
The Bear’s will host the #3 nationally-ranked Creighton Blue Jays on Tuesday October 21st at 7:00 pm at Plaster Stadium. The last time the Blue Jay’s visited, Springfield set a soccer attendance record while earning a tie on a late goal by Justin Douglass.
